    Quote Originally Posted by Sam_oslo View Post
    This looks much cleaner without the tubing from res to pump, which can easily become a mess av crossing tubings. You don't need to worry about space for those either.

    If the performance is the same, this may be the next evaluation in WC. How is the performance compared to those anyways?
    Perf of the new kits is necessarily a tiny little better in an apple to apple (dual rad to dual rad) since there is less flow restriction, but it is minimal. It's essentially the same. But the performance RANGE is infinitely (an intentional exageration) superior with the new PWM pump. it's a subjective thing for me, because I always hated the noise of the 350 series compared to the 650's. I love being able to run my pump and fans at silent level for day-to-day, and crank up the speed to the max for benching!

    Quote Originally Posted by Philwong View Post
    3. Perhaps powering the pump from a 4-pin molex, while routing PWM and RPM signals to the mobo header would be a more conservative approach? After all, a MCP355 draws up to 18W peak power.

    4. Are the fill ports using standard thread sizes?
    3. MCP350 and MCP355 already have their power wires on a 4-pin molex connector and the tach wire on a separate 3-pin connector. They probably replaced the 3-pin by a PWM style 4-pin and kept the PSU style 4-pin molex for the power wires.

    4. I think Swiftech said they were switching all their PG11 fill port to G1/4, probably the case here.

    Philwong, in regards to question number 1, at 1300RPM (0% PWM duty, a.k.a., minimum speed), the MPC35X/DDC3.25 should provide less pumping power than a D5 at setting 1.

    It'll work, but if you increase the speed, temperatures will improve. 55% duty looks to be roughly equivalent to a DDC3.1, and should be a hair behind your D5-B (and probably be quieter).
